Torque Specs and Fluid Capacities – Why the Foreword Matters

Section 01 includes the standard tightening torque table and the table of fuel, coolant, and lubricants. That torque table – located in the Foreword – is critical for every bolt you touch. I’ve seen guys snap head bolts because they used a generic torque chart. Komatsu specifies the proper values for each fastener grade. The fluid capacity table tells you exactly how much engine oil, transmission oil, and coolant the D575A-3 holds. Don’t guess on a dozer this size; overfilling the hydraulic tank causes foaming and pump damage. You also get a conversion table and electric wire code – essential when you’re tracing a harness and need to know which wire is which.

Does This Manual Cover the SA12V170E-2 Engine?

Yes – the D575A-3 mounts the SA12V170E-2 engine. The manual references the separate engine shop manual for complete engine overhaul, but it includes plenty of engine-related testing and adjusting procedures in section 20. You’ll find standard value tables for engine measurements, compression pressure checks, blow-by pressure testing, and valve clearance adjustment. If you need to pull the engine or rebuild it, pick up the dedicated engine manual. But for tuning and diagnostics on the dozer itself, this workshop manual has everything: measuring fuel injection timing, adjusting fan belt tension, and testing the alternator belt. Page 20-1 kicks off the testing section with a list of required tools – that’s where you start before you touch anything.

7 Major Systems Covered in Section 10

Section 10 covers structure, function, and maintenance standards for seven major systems: the radiator and oil cooler, engine control, power train (including torque converter, transmission, steering clutch, final drive), undercarriage (track frame, idler, rollers, track shoe), suspension, hydraulic work equipment (main control valve, PPC valve, blade control), and the air conditioner. Each subsystem has its own detailed breakdown. For example, the torque converter lock-up control system gets its own subsection with hydraulic piping diagrams. If you’re rebuilding the steering brakes, the steering clutch and brake subsection shows you the internal parts and clearances. You won’t find this level of detail in a generic service manual.

Testing and Adjusting: The 20-Series Section

Section 20 is where the real diagnostic work happens. It starts with standard value tables for the engine, chassis, and electrical parts. Then comes step-by-step procedures: measuring boost pressure, exhaust temperature, torque converter stall speed – even a full stall test that combines converter stall and hydraulic pump relief. You also get procedures for releasing the steering brake, adjusting brake pedal linkage, and testing track shoe tension. The troubleshooting portion at the end of section 20 is worth the price alone. It walks you through the sequence of events when something goes wrong, connector arrangement diagrams, and a T-branch box table for electrical diagnosis. I’ve used these charts to find intermittent sensor faults in under an hour – way faster than swapping parts.

Wiring Diagrams: Factory Standard for Electrical Troubleshooting

The manual includes actual electrical wiring diagrams for the entire machine – engine control system, monitor system, blade control system, and mode selection. These are not simplified schematics; they show every connector pin and wire color per Komatsu’s own electric wire code. If you’re dealing with a no-crank or a blade that drifts, you need these diagrams. The troubleshooting section also explains the monitor panel’s special functions and how to use the network system (N mode) diagnostic charts. Without these, you’re poking blindly at a harness that costs thousands to replace.

Can I use this manual to service the torque converter?
Absolutely. Section 10 covers the torque converter, PTO, torque converter valve, lock-up control system, and filter. Section 20 includes stall speed measurement procedures – critical for diagnosing converter wear. Without factory stall RPM values, you’re guessing on stator condition. The testing section also covers full stall (converter + hydraulic pump relief) which is the proper way to check pump health.
